We did it back in 2005 and unless it’s improved significantly then I wouldn’t recommend it. DS was 7 and DD5 at the time and the show was entertaining enough for the kids but nothing special.
The food was diabolical! We had chicken and it was hard and cold to the point that it was almost inedible. The drinks that they brought round were warm and the service was very slow, we felt deliberately so, so that people couldn’t take advantage of the all inclusive drinks. It was so bad that it is the only place in America where I’ve ever refused to tip!
